Hollywood Squares first aired in 1965, running into the 1980s in its original form. Hosted by the charismatic Peter Marshall, the show pitted Hollywood's funniest and most famous against each other in a game designed to produce funniest quips and one-liners. 


Although there is a modern version, there is something about the '70s version that perfectly captures its moment in time.
